Your role at Baxter

As the Customer Service Supervisor you will directly lead and support a team related to a segment or segments of the organization's customer-facing operations. This position is accountable for ensuring that customer orders, returns and credits, complaints, requests, etc. are resolved in a timely, accurate, and cost-effective manner upon the first request.

What you'll be doing

  • Following company policy and stated terms of sale, develop effective systems and procedures to ensure the effectiveness of the Customer Service Department operations.
  • Coordinates the activities of the Customer Service department with other internal departments, third party distributors, transportation, operations, customers and sales staff.
  • Supervise all department employee's workload and may need to balance workloads and adjusts assignments to obtain most effective performance from all employees.
  • Ensure that new employees are properly trained. May be involved in delivering training to staff as needed. Perform call monitoring and skill verification. Responsible for staffing, performance reviews, employee development, and salary reviews.
  • Receive and answer inquiries from customers, sales staff, other internal departments, and vendors. Use judgment and diplomacy to handle complaints, make adjustments, answer or initiate correspondence and perform all other duties involving public contact.
  • Escalation point for specialists on problems requiring special handling or those not able to be resolved at front-line level. Contact parties involved and take necessary action to resolve problems with internal departments and vendors (ex. Distribution). Take proactive steps as appropriate.
  • Accountable as Area/Regional Key Contact for Distribution POC and Business Unit for service failure tracking, decision making and full resolution within timely basis.
  • May serve on project teams and/or help develop new processes and procedures for the overall team.
  • May have responsibility for implementing compliance procedures with federal and state regulations.

What you'll bring

  • Associate or Bachelors degree preferred.
  • 1 year or more of relevant work experience within most recent 5 years, preferably in a regulated industry or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Strong communication, interpersonal, and leadership skills.
  • Strong process and results orientations.
  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a matrix environment.
  • Detailed understanding of customer service tools, systems and business processes
  • Strong track record of prioritizing initiatives based on internal business acumen
  • Strong organ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team,


We understand compensation is an important factor as you consider the next step in your career. At Baxter, we are committed to equitable pay for all employees, and we strive to be more transparent with our pay practices. The estimated base salary for this position is $64,000 - $88,000 annually. The estimated range is meant to reflect an anticipated salary range for the position. We may pay more or less than of the anticipated range based upon market data and other factors, all of which are subject to change. Individual pay is based on upon location, skills and expertise, experience, and other relevant factors. This position may also be eligible for discretionary bonuses. US Benefits at Baxter (except for Puerto Rico)

This is where your well-being matters. Baxter offers comprehensive compensation and benefits packages for eligible roles. Our health and well-being benefits include medical and dental coverage that start on day one, as well as insurance coverage for basic life, accident, short-term and long-term disability, and business travel accident insurance. Financial and retirement benefits include the Employee Stock Purchase Plan (ESPP), with the ability to purchase company stock at a discount, and the 401(k) Retirement Savings Plan (RSP), with options for employee contributions and company matching. We also offer Flexible Spending Accounts, educational assistance programs, and time-off benefits such as paid holidays, paid time off ranging from 20 to 35 days based on length of service, family and medical leaves of absence, and paid parental leave. Additional benefits include commuting benefits, the Employee Discount Program, the Employee Assistance Program (EAP), and childcare benefits.
